Tarsiers have remarkable eyesight, especially in low light conditions, which is critical for their nocturnal lifestyle. Their vision is adapted for seeing well in dim light, allowing them to navigate and hunt effectively in the dark forest canopy. While it's challenging to quantify their visual range precisely, tarsiers can see significantly better in low light compared to humans.
Key features of tarsier vision include:
1. **Large Eyes:** Tarsiers have disproportionately large eyes compared to their body size. These large eyes allow them to capture more light and enhance their ability to see in the dark.
2. **Nocturnal Adaptations:** Tarsiers have adaptations in their retinas and eye structures that optimize their vision in low light. They have a higher density of rod cells in their retinas, which are more sensitive to low light than cone cells. This adaptation enhances their night vision.
3. **Excellent Depth Perception:** Tarsiers have excellent depth perception, which helps them judge distances accurately in the three-dimensional forest canopy. This is crucial for leaping from branch to branch and capturing prey.
4. **Binocular Vision:** Tarsiers have forward-facing eyes that provide binocular vision. This arrangement allows them to overlap their visual fields, improving their depth perception and the ability to focus on objects with precision.
While the exact range of tarsier vision in terms of distance may be challenging to determine, their adaptations for nocturnal and arboreal life make them well-suited for navigating and hunting in the dark. Tarsiers can detect prey, such as insects, and move through the trees with agility and accuracy, thanks to their exceptional night vision.
